"A Puppet Explains!" is an ongoing YouTube series (self-written and produced).
You can subscribe by clicking here.
Performance Gallery
Rob has worked as an actor in the Philadelphia region since 2007. With a strong background in improvisation and devised theatre-making, Rob enjoys processes with opportunities to collaborate as not only a performer, but as a member of the design and creative team. As a company member of Transmissions Theatre from 2007-2012, Rob developed a love for devising original content as an actor and performer while building and creating puppets.